Synopsis
Embark on an exciting journey into the animal kingdom with 'Why Are Tigers Striped?' This engaging book answers curious questions about nature, exploring the unique features and behaviours of various animals. Discover the secrets behind a tiger's stripes, the purpose of a zebra's patterns, and much more. Perfect for young readers eager to learn about the wonders of wildlife.
About the author
Andrew Langley is a British author who has written many exciting non-fiction books for children. He loves exploring topics like history, science, food, and famous people. Andrew’s books make learning fun and easy to understand, helping readers discover amazing facts about the world around them.
